Rate of disappearance and equations
-delta(reactant)/Delta:time
Delta(products)/Delta:time
set reactants and products to be equal to each other, and put recirpical of moles in front of the correspnding thing, and put all over Delta T
rate law
rate=KA^MB^N
order is based on either if the M or N is 0, 1, or 2
integrated rate laws
0th: A1-A2=-kt
1st: lnA1-lnA2=-kt
2nd: 1/A1-1/A2=kt
factors affecting reaction rate
Concentration up, surface area increase, and as T increase
Reaction needed conditions
Orientation, collision, and energy.
Catalyst
Increases rate of chemical reaction by providing different pathway with lower EA, and or increased rxn collisions. Used in rxn and remade in the end of rxn.
Surface catalyst
A reactant or intermediate forms a covalent bond or binds to a surface
